Educating the Modern Consumer on Plant-Based Benefits
One of the most influential trends in the vegan yogurt industry is the emphasis on consumer education. Brands are investing in educational content that communicates the health, environmental, and ethical benefits of plant-based yogurt over traditional dairy options. From high-fiber and protein-rich formulations to gut health and lactose-free benefits, companies are making it easier for consumers to understand why switching to vegan yogurt is a smart choice.
Educational campaigns take many forms—blogs, newsletters, infographics, short videos, and social media posts—all designed to break down complex nutritional or environmental data into digestible, engaging formats. In-store materials and packaging labels now frequently highlight these benefits as well, making the message consistent across all consumer touchpoints.
This proactive education not only informs but empowers consumers, helping them make conscious and informed decisions aligned with their personal values, such as wellness, sustainability, or animal welfare.
The Rise of Social Media as a Marketing Powerhouse
In parallel with education efforts, social media has become a cornerstone of vegan yogurt marketing. Platforms like Instagram, TikTok, Facebook, and YouTube offer powerful tools for storytelling, brand building, and customer interaction. Through visually appealing content—ranging from product demos and recipe videos to customer testimonials and influencer partnerships—brands are able to reach large audiences quickly and authentically.
Influencer marketing, in particular, has become one of the most effective methods for expanding reach. Vegan and health-focused influencers often serve as trusted voices, introducing new products to followers in a relatable, lifestyle-driven context. A single influencer’s endorsement can lead to spikes in interest and sales, especially when paired with discount codes, giveaways, or limited-time product drops.
Brands like Oatly, Forager Project, and Silk have successfully leveraged social media to not only promote new product launches but to also reinforce brand identity and values. Consistent engagement through comments, stories, and user-generated content helps maintain long-term visibility and loyalty.

Case Studies: How Top Brands Leverage Digital Campaigns
Several top players in the vegan yogurt space have successfully used consumer education and social media to drive growth. For example:
-
Oatly: Known for its witty and transparent communication, Oatly has educated consumers on the environmental impact of dairy farming versus oat production through creative ads, videos, and social posts. Its “Wow No Cow” campaign is a prime example of blending education with humor.
-
Kite Hill: This brand focuses on clean ingredients and culinary sophistication. Its Instagram features a mix of educational content on plant-based nutrition and gourmet vegan recipes, catering to foodies and health enthusiasts.
-
Chobani (Plant-Based Range): Leveraging its well-established dairy brand recognition, Chobani uses targeted ads and influencer partnerships to promote its plant-based offerings while highlighting the health benefits of non-dairy yogurt alternatives.
These campaigns have helped brands not only attract new customers but also retain existing ones through regular engagement and transparent storytelling.
Challenges and Future Opportunities
Despite the success of digital education and outreach, there are still challenges in reaching underserved markets or consumers skeptical about plant-based diets. Not all regions have equal access to vegan products or the digital platforms where these campaigns thrive. Brands looking to expand globally must consider localized education efforts, language nuances, and cultural sensitivities.
In the future, integrating AI-driven personalization, immersive experiences like augmented reality, and interactive live events could further elevate how vegan yogurt brands educate and engage their audiences. Collaborations with nutritionists, chefs, and sustainability advocates will also play a role in enriching the dialogue and increasing credibility.
